which shape is not a trapezoid

Respuesta :

Аноним Аноним
  • 03-03-2021

Answer:

trapezium

If the shape you're looking at doesn't have at least one set of parallel sides, it's not a trapezoid; it's something called a trapezium instead. Similarly, if the shape has two sets of parallel sides, it's not a trapezoid. It's either a rectangle, a parallelogram shape or a rhombus.
